Output 052edbfbcf5110cd6a88f3ece68cb219df25b845cb8638247061014f88d10e13:1

value
680424
script pubkey
OP_0 OP_PUSHBYTES_20 5214c2b781c84b1fc564c31e45dfee373bbd077a
address
tb1q2g2v9dupep93l3tycv0ythlwxuam6pm6xyp9jg
transaction
052edbfbcf5110cd6a88f3ece68cb219df25b845cb8638247061014f88d10e13
confirmations
101762
spent
true